How they compare
Malawi currently reports 246 against 229 in New Zealand, a difference of 17.
That makes Malawi's figure about 1.1 times New Zealand's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was New Zealand ahead.
Malawi ranks 80th and New Zealand ranks 83rd of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Malawi averaged higher in 3 and New Zealand in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Malawi | New Zealand |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 60 | 91 | 31 | New Zealand |
| 1970s | 70.5 | 118 | 47.5 | New Zealand |
| 1980s | 109.5 | 132.5 | 23 | New Zealand |
| 1990s | 161.5 | 140 | 21.5 | Malawi |
| 2000s | 201.5 | 166.5 | 35 | Malawi |
| 2010s | 246 | 229 | 17 | Malawi |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
